  • QuestionWaht are the Screen Dimensions--Width and Hgt? Waht is the assembled Weight? Thanks

    Asked by Bubba.

    • Answer Hi Bubba, Thank you for your inquiry. The KD75X750H TV dimensions and weight are the following: DIMENSION OF TV WITHOUT STAND (W X H X D) Approx. 66.5 x 38.25 x 3.25 " (1,686 x 970 x 80 mm) WEIGHT OF TV WITHOUT STAND Approx. 67.7 lb (30.7 kg) DIMENSION OF TV WITH STAND (W X H X D) Approx. 66.5 x 40.88 x 16.38 " (1,686 x 1,038 x 414 mm) WEIGHT OF TV WITH STAND Approx. 69.9 lb (31.7 kg) SCREEN SIZE (MEASURED DIAGONALLY) 75" (74.5") INCH or 189 CM For reference, please refer to this link: https://www.sony.com/electronics/support/televisions-projectors-lcd-tvs-android-/kd-75x750h/specifications Regards, Kris

  • QuestionIs the VESA mounting panel on the back of the TV in the exact center of the back of the TV or is it offset toward the top or bottom? A second question is; Is there a dimensional drawing or install guide that shows the back?

    Asked by Chaz.

    • Answer Hi Chaz, Thank you for your interest with one of our Sony TVs. The mount holes for the KD75X750H TV are more likely on the center. These TVs work with any VESA Compliant wall mount bracket with a screw hole pattern of 11 7/8 x 11 7/8 (inch) or 300*300mm. For product protection and safety reasons, Sony strongly recommends that the installation of your TV on a wall be performed by qualified professionals. Wall mounts come in many shapes and sizes. The various shapes and sizes are meant to try and meet the performance needs, space or wall requirements, desired styles and safety. Please contact your local retailer to find a VESA stand that meets the size of your TV, your wall or environmental requirements, and stylistic preferences. For more detailed wall mount specifications and Sony recommended wall mounts, please open this link: https://www.sony.com/electronics/support/articles/00124300 You may also open this link with details of the TV dimension diagram: http://www.sonypremiumhome.com/pdfs/75X750H-Dimensions-Drawing.pdf Regards, Kris

  • QuestionCan you connect BlueTooth headphones to this TV?

    Asked by AJ.

    • Answer Hi Aj, Thank you for your inquiry. The X750H does not support A2DP (Advanced Audio Distribution Profile) Bluetooth profile which is needed in order to connect a Bluetooth headphone to the TV. The Bluetooth profile of the TV is only for mouse/keyboard connectivity. As a work around, you can use RF wireless headphones with their own transmitter connected to the AUDIO OUT port of the TV. If you are looking for compatible A2DP Bluetooth profile TVs, please check out our 2020 X900H or X90CH model and up and our new 2021 line up X80J and up for this feature. Regards, Kris
